The Santa Barbara Maritime Museum is pleased to announce the opening of its latest exhibition ICE BEAR, a selection of photographs by Ralph Clevenger. The polar bear images in this exhibit were taken on an eight-day trip with Frontiers North Adventures to the shores of Hudson Bay near Churchill, Manitoba, Canada.
